<center><H1>Tarboro Certified Pre Owned Ferrari Sales - (770) 547 1202</H1></center> <BR> When
considering a vehicle purchase, it is very important to understand
your options. There are more
factors to consider than merely
new or used; decreasing the
used-vehicle course will likewise
demand a choice in
between buying from a personal seller or
a dealership. Even amongst
secondhand vehicles at
the dealership lot, there's a subset
advertised as "certified
previously owned," or CPO, which are
generally sold through
certified new-car dealers.
Given that they
normally include
a much better guarantee,
relatively modest miles, and an extensive
assessment, CPO
cars strike a potentially engaging middle ground
between new and utilized. <BR>
Here are 5 reasons a
licensed previously owned (CPO)
vehicle might be best
for you: <BR> 1. It's Cheaper Than Purchasing New <BR>
Let's get the most
apparent reason out of the way. New
cars and trucks and trucks are, by
nature, more pricey than their utilized
brethren. Usually, two-year-old CPO
cars are
typically 25 percent more affordable, and those 4 years old tend to be 40 percent less
costly.
However, it is necessary to bear in mind that CPO
lorries do bring a premium
over their non-CPO used equivalents.
The concern purchasers require to ask
themselves is: Do the additional
advantages of purchasing a
CPO justify the greater rate?
<BR> 2. There's a Manufacturer-Backed Service
warranty <BR> And that gets us into another
factor why a CPO makes
good sense for specific purchasers.
Since with that premium,
car manufacturers offer a
range of manufacturer-backed service
warranties. Similar to the
cars and trucks they
assist accredit, not all
warranties are
developed equivalent,
however, so purchasers will wish to pay unique attention to the
service warranty specifics. There are
powertrain-limited warranties and
bumper-to-bumper service warranties, and
several automakers
offer combinations of both. <BR> Powertrain
warranties
generally span longer
durations, such as 6 years or 100,000 miles from
the date the vehicle was
purchased new. A bumper-to-bumper
guarantee may last for one
year or cover 12,000 miles and might include
a deductible of $50 to $100. When looking
for a CPO, purchasers must be sure to
inquire about the length of the
service warranty, the details
relating to types of
repairs that require paying a deductible, and
the list of items not covered at all. Pay attention to whether the
manufacturer has a cost to
move a CPO guarantee
ought to you desire to offer
the automobile or truck before the warranty expires.
(BMW, for instance, charges $200 for the
service warranty to be transferred to
a subsequent owner.). <BR> 3. The Car
Has Been Inspected. <BR> Among the reasons a service
warranty is used in the very first
location is because
manufacturers make sure
CPO vehicles, trucks, and SUVs
remain in solid working order prior to
they offer them up for sale. Unlike an as-is
used automobile that you'll find on a dealer lot
or listed by a private seller, CPO
lorries are executed a relatively extensive
evaluation checklist.
Ford and General Motors, for example, have 172
items the car manufacturers say
professionals
need to complete prior to approving a used Ford, Buick, GMC, or Chevrolet
vehicle as CPO. If you're not
especially mechanically likely, the
relative comfort buying CPO
can provide could be well worth it. <BR>

picture-in-picture" allowfullscreen></iframe><BR> 4. CPO
Automobiles Still Have a Lot of
Life in Them. <BR> To qualify as CPO, an automobile typically
must meet age and mileage
constraints. This, too,
varies by manufacturer, but
usually CPO
cars and trucks are not
more than five to six years of ages and have
less than 75,000 miles on them. Many producers will include benefits such as 24-hour roadside
service and SiriusXM radio with a CPO purchase. <BR> 5. You Get
Less Range, However CPOs You'll Find
Are Option. <BR> If you're looking for a Porsche 911 with a manual transmission and
a couple of specific
choices-- as we
often aimlessly find ourselves
doing-- looking for one that is
used as a CPO is most likely
just this side of difficult. Even when
looking for something more
common, among utilized
cars and trucks on a
dealership lot, the huge majority aren't CPO.
One car dealership in Ann Arbor, Michigan,
for example, has 1507
utilized automobiles
listed for sale on its site, just 63 of
which are CPO. The smaller numbers are
described-- and justified-- by
the variety of criteria we have
actually simply described that CPO
lorries have to
meet. Some car manufacturers
offer buyers a time
period, such as three days or 150 miles,
to test out a CPO and choose whether
they 'd rather swap it out for something else.<BR><BR>
